About Xuehui Zhao

Xuehui Zhao is a scholar working on Behavioral Neuroscience, Aging and Biological Psychiatry, having authored 38 papers that have together received 572 indexed citations. Recurring topics across this work include Plant Reproductive Biology (6 papers), Neuroscience and Neuropharmacology Research (6 papers) and Plant Molecular Biology Research (6 papers). The work is most often cited by research in Aging (38 citations), Biological Psychiatry (33 citations) and Neurology (83 citations). Xuehui Zhao has collaborated with scholars based in China, Japan and Denmark. Frequent co-authors include Yasuyuki Nomura, Yoshihisa Kitamura, Toshio Ohnuki, Yoshihisa Kitamura, Xiude Chen, Xiling Fu, Yuguang Wang, Masao Hattori, Ben-Xiang Wang and Tsuneo Namba. Their work appears in journals such as SHILAP Revista de lepidopterología, Journal of Experimental Botany and Optics Express.
